A profession in pharmacy is both challenging and rewarding, offering opportunities to make the lives of patients daily. Obtaining a Certification in Pharmacy Practice can be your first step towards this gratifying path. This qualification provides you with the essential knowledge and skills to work as a competent pharmacy technician, assisting pharmacists in various aspects of medication management.
With a diploma in hand, you can land entry-level positions in hospitals, gaining valuable knowledge and building a strong foundation for future career progression. The need for qualified pharmacy technicians is steadily increasing, making this a stable choice for those seeking a profession with excellent prospects.
- Gain essential skills in medication dispensing, compounding, and patient counseling.
- Collaborate alongside pharmacists to ensure accurate and timely drug delivery.
- Contribute to the health and well-being of patients within a healthcare setting.

Embracing Excellence: DPharmacy Course Details and Curriculum
Embark on a transformative journey in the field of pharmacy with a comprehensive DPharmacy program. This rigorous syllabus equips you with the theoretical knowledge and practical abilities essential for success as a licensed pharmacist. The course spans diverse aspects of pharmaceutical science, including pharmacology, therapeutics, pharmaceutics, and pharmaceutical care.
Gain essential insights into drug effects, formulation, and patient management. Develop advanced clinical judgment skills through hands-on experience in simulated settings.
